This patch converts core_tpg_set_initiator_node_queue_depth() to use struct se_node_acl->acl_sess_list when performing explicit se_tpg_tfo->shutdown_session() for active sessions, in order for new se_node_acl->queue_depth to take effect. This follows how core_tpg_del_initiator_node_acl() currently works when invoking se_tpg_tfo->shutdown-session(), and ahead of the next patch to take se_node_acl->acl_kref during lookup, the extra get_initiator_node_acl() can go away. In order to achieve this, go ahead and change target_get_session() to use kref_get_unless_zero() and propigate up the return value to know when a session is already being released. This is because se_node_acl->acl_group is already protecting se_node_acl->acl_group reference via configfs, and shutdown within core_tpg_del_initiator_node_acl() won't occur until sys_write() to core_tpg_set_initiator_node_queue_depth() attribute returns back to user-space. Also, drop the left-over iscsi-target hack, and obtain se_portal_group->session_lock in lio_tpg_shutdown_session() internally. Remove iscsi-target wrapper and unused se_tpg + force parameters and associated code.
